Muscletech reveal 20th Essential Series supplement Platinum ISO-Zero

While we have been left wondering about the future of Muscletech’s Arnold Classic previewed Platinum Gakic and Platinum Test Booster. The brand have gone and revealed number 20 for their Essential Series, with the line’s fourth protein powder Platinum ISO-Zero. For those international Muscletech fans the name might seem familiar, as it is exactly the same as the non-US Performance Series supplement ISO-Zero. There are a lot of things separating the two aside from the Platinum title. With the pure whey isolate protein unflavored and featuring per (27g) scoop, 25g of protein, zero fat, zero carbohydrates, and a total of 100 calories. Each tub of Platinum ISO-Zero weighs in at 1.5lbs, although due to it’s extremely straightforward formula. It packs just one less 25g protein serving than Muscletech’s other fine Platinum protein, 100% ISO-Whey. As mentioned, the product does look to be an unflavored only supplement. Which we feel could see the brand become even more competitive with their new range of proteins. Especially if ISO-Zero follows the Essential Series trend and comes in a double or more size tub.
